The section containing Hadith numbers 36199 to 36205 in Al-Musannaf by Ibn Abi Shaybah presents a collection of prophetic traditions and reports transmitted through early Islamic authorities. These narrations reflect Ibn Abi Shaybah’s method of compiling authentic and relevant reports related to daily worship, social conduct, and community life in early Islam. The selected hadiths demonstrate the diversity of narrations among the companions and successors, offering valuable insight into legal reasoning, moral instruction, and the transmission of knowledge. This portion of Al-Musannaf serves as an important reference for scholars studying early hadith compilation, authenticity, and thematic classification within Islamic jurisprudence and history.
